/// Possible transaction status events.
///
/// # Note
///
/// This is copied from `sp-transaction-pool` to avoid a dependency on that crate. Therefore it
/// must be kept compatible with that type from the target substrate version.
#[derive(Debug, Clone, PartialEq, Serialize, Deserialize)]
#[serde(rename_all = "camelCase")]
pub enum TransactionStatus<Hash, BlockHash> {
/// Transaction is part of the future queue.
Future,
/// Transaction is part of the ready queue.
Ready,
/// The transaction has been broadcast to the given peers.
Broadcast(Vec<String>),
/// Transaction has been included in block with given hash.
InBlock(BlockHash),
/// The block this transaction was included in has been retracted.
Retracted(BlockHash),
/// Maximum number of finality watchers has been reached,
/// old watchers are being removed.
FinalityTimeout(BlockHash),
/// Transaction has been finalized by a finality-gadget, e.g GRANDPA
Finalized(BlockHash),
/// Transaction has been replaced in the pool, by another transaction
/// that provides the same tags. (e.g. same (sender, nonce)).
Usurped(Hash),
/// Transaction has been dropped from the pool because of the limit.
Dropped,
/// Transaction is no longer valid in the current state.
Invalid,
}

/// Rpc client wrapper.
/// This is workaround because adding generic types causes the macros to fail.
#[derive(Clone)]
pub enum RpcClient {
/// JSONRPC client WebSocket transport.
WebSocket(WsClient),
/// JSONRPC client HTTP transport.
// NOTE: Arc because `HttpClient` is not clone.
Http(Arc<HttpClient>),
#[cfg(any(feature = "client", test))]
/// Embedded substrate node.
Subxt(SubxtClient),
}
impl RpcClient {
/// Start a JSON-RPC request.
pub async fn request<T: DeserializeOwned>(
&self,
method: &str,
params: Params,
) -> Result<T, Error> {
match self {
Self::WebSocket(inner) => {
inner.request(method, params).await.map_err(Into::into)
}
Self::Http(inner) => inner.request(method, params).await.map_err(Into::into),
#[cfg(any(feature = "client", test))]
Self::Subxt(inner) => inner.request(method, params).await.map_err(Into::into),
}
}
/// Start a JSON-RPC Subscription.
pub async fn subscribe<T: DeserializeOwned>(
&self,
subscribe_method: &str,
params: Params,
unsubscribe_method: &str,
) -> Result<Subscription<T>, Error> {
match self {
Self::WebSocket(inner) => {
inner
.subscribe(subscribe_method, params, unsubscribe_method)
.await
.map_err(Into::into)
}
Self::Http(_) => {
Err(RpcError::Custom(
"Subscriptions not supported on HTTP transport".to_owned(),
)
.into())
}
#[cfg(any(feature = "client", test))]
Self::Subxt(inner) => {
inner
.subscribe(subscribe_method, params, unsubscribe_method)
.await
.map_err(Into::into)
}
}
}
}

/// Create and submit an extrinsic and return corresponding Event if successful
pub async fn submit_and_watch_extrinsic<'a, E: Encode + 'static>(
&self,
extrinsic: E,
decoder: &'a EventsDecoder<T>,
) -> Result<ExtrinsicSuccess<T>, Error> {
let ext_hash = T::Hashing::hash_of(&extrinsic);
log::info!("Submitting Extrinsic `{:?}`", ext_hash);
let events_sub = self.subscribe_events().await?;
let mut xt_sub = self.watch_extrinsic(extrinsic).await?;
while let Some(status) = xt_sub.next().await {
// log::info!("received status {:?}", status);
match status {
// ignore in progress extrinsic for now
TransactionStatus::Future
| TransactionStatus::Ready
| TransactionStatus::Broadcast(_) => continue,
TransactionStatus::InBlock(block_hash) => {
log::info!("Fetching block {:?}", block_hash);
let block = self.block(Some(block_hash)).await?;
return match block {
Some(signed_block) => {
log::info!(
"Found block {:?}, with {} extrinsics",
block_hash,
signed_block.block.extrinsics.len()
);
let ext_index = signed_block
.block
.extrinsics
.iter()
.position(|ext| {
let hash = T::Hashing::hash_of(ext);
hash == ext_hash
})
.ok_or_else(|| {
Error::Other(format!(
"Failed to find Extrinsic with hash {:?}",
ext_hash,
))
})?;
let mut sub = EventSubscription::new(events_sub, &decoder);
sub.filter_extrinsic(block_hash, ext_index);
let mut events = vec![];
while let Some(event) = sub.next().await {
events.push(event?);
}
Ok(ExtrinsicSuccess {
block: block_hash,
extrinsic: ext_hash,
events,
})
}
None => {
Err(format!("Failed to find block {:?}", block_hash).into())
}
}
}
TransactionStatus::Invalid => return Err("Extrinsic Invalid".into()),
TransactionStatus::Usurped(_) => return Err("Extrinsic Usurped".into()),
TransactionStatus::Dropped => return Err("Extrinsic Dropped".into()),
TransactionStatus::Retracted(_) => {
return Err("Extrinsic Retracted".into())
}
// should have made it `InBlock` before either of these
TransactionStatus::Finalized(_) => {
return Err("Extrinsic Finalized".into())
}
TransactionStatus::FinalityTimeout(_) => {
return Err("Extrinsic FinalityTimeout".into())
}
}
}
Err(RpcError::Custom("RPC subscription dropped".into()).into())
}
